Kalshi: US Crypto Markets
- Operates under CFTC oversight, permissible for American participants
- Restricted crypto selection (chiefly BTC valuations)
- Extended payout timelines, currency-based funding only
- Restricted to American users exclusively

- Can I use leverage on crypto prediction markets?
- Leverage is unavailable — all prediction market stakes require complete upfront payment. You purchase the complete YES or NO contract at its quoted price. Margin and liquidation mechanics do not apply.
